For all ppc compilers, implement pg_atomic_fetch_add_ with inline asm.

This is more like how we handle s_lock.h and arch-x86.h.  This does not
materially affect code generation for gcc 7.2.0 or xlc 13.1.3.

Reviewed by Tom Lane.
